SCES Mission
We encourage interactive and diverse artistic experiences through creative programming for all people in Saskatchewan.
SCES Values
Innovative; Accountable and well-governed; Diverse and inclusive; Collaborative
Volunteer Opportunity
In the 30-year history of the Saskatchewan Cultural Exchange, the organization has successfully increased cultural programming and artistic experiences for the province. The Board of Directors has an important role in the overall reach and success of the organization.
We are currently looking to fill a few vacancies within the Board of Directors.
The commitment is a two year term, with 4-6 meetings a year, and invitation to attend events and happening hosted by the organization. All expenses to attend or join meetings via teleconference will be covered by the organization.
The Saskatchewan Cultural Exchange strives to provide diverse and cultural programming and artistic experiences across Saskatchewan. Through a policy governance structure, the Board ensures the organization has the means necessary to carry out the organization’s strategic ends, by developing policy, approving the annual budget and setting the strategic vision, mission, values and goals of the organization.
There is no prior board or policy governance experience required to apply for the role of board director. In fact, one of the objectives of the Board is to provide learning and volunteer opportunities for people in Saskatchewan. We want people to grow their own experiences with policy governance and arts development in Saskatchewan.
